How much do summer position j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 13, 2026, the average hourly pay for summer position in Rome, GA is $15.89,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$13.46 and $17.55 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a summer position?

Summer positions are temporary jobs or internships offered during the summer months, typically to students or individuals seeking short-term employment. These roles can be found in a variety of industries, such as retail, hospitality, education, camps, or corporate internships. Summer positions provide valuable work experience, a chance to earn money, and opportunities to learn new skills. Many students use summer positions to explore career interests and build their resumes for future employment.

What types of projects or tasks can I expect to work on in a summer position?

In a summer position, you'll typically assist with short-term projects or help teams with increased workloads during the busy season. Daily tasks may include administrative support, data entry, customer service, or hands-on work specific to the industry, such as assisting with events, research, or production. Summer positions often provide opportunities to collaborate with full-time employees, gain practical experience, and learn about the organization's workflow. This exposure can help you develop valuable skills and potentially open doors for future employment within the company.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in a summer position, and why are they important?

To thrive in a summer position, you generally need strong organizational skills, reliability, and a willingness to learn, with minimal formal qualifications required beyond a high school diploma or current student status. Familiarity with basic office software, point-of-sale systems, or industry-specific tools may be beneficial depending on the role. Strong communication, teamwork, and a positive attitude help individuals stand out in these roles. These skills and qualities are important because they ensure productivity, adaptability, and a positive contribution to temporary teams or projects.

What is the difference between Summer Position vs Intern?

AspectSummer PositionIntern
CredentialsVaries; often no formal requirementsTypically students or recent graduates; may require enrollment in a program
Work EnvironmentTemporary, seasonal, often in retail, hospitality, or outdoor settingsTemporary, educational focus, in offices, labs, or corporate settings
Employer UsageUsed by a wide range of industries for seasonal workCommonly used in corporate, tech, and professional sectors for training

In summary, a Summer Position generally refers to seasonal, often entry-level work without strict credentials, while an Intern typically involves a structured learning experience for students or recent graduates. Both are temporary roles but serve different purposes in career development and industry needs.

Job description

Why This Internship

As an intern with Textron, you'll gain hands-on experience while exploring your interests and building new skills. You'll be supported and challenged to contribute in meaningful ways - working on real projects alongside experienced professionals to prepare for future success.

Responsibilities:

  • Build plans, production tooling, and manufacturing processes for components and assemblies. \\
  • Redesign tooling to improve operators' work environments. 
  • Analyze layouts and production processes to improve facility layouts for product flow. 
  • Creating reference documents and standardized work for new or improved processes.  
  • Analyze quality concerns, make recommendations for improvement, and implement ideas. 
  • Exploring new equipment and software that can reduce scrap and downtime and recommend changes to production flow to implement recommendations.    
  • Monitor, communicate and improve key supply chain KPI's including PPM, line disruptions and days to close non-conforming material tickets (NCMT). 
  • Develop and initiate standards and methods for inspection, testing, and evaluation. 
  • Evaluate production processes to increase productivity and investigate methods to enhance the product.  
  • Coordinate material and tooling availability with appropriate stakeholders.
